2019-02-24 The Four Noble Truths 56:05
Sally Armstrong
The Buddha taught the Four Noble Truths – the truths of suffering, the cause of suffering , the end of suffering and the path to the end of suffering – not as a philosophy, but as practices that we can use here and now to understand why we suffer and how to find release. Using this template to gain insight into our lives can bring a radical shift to the way we relate to our experience.

2019-02-23 Non Greed, Non Hatred, Non Delusion (Retreat at Spirit Rock) 64:41
James Baraz
Non-Greed, Non-Hatred and Non-Delusion were taught by the Buddha as the three roots of happiness. Stating each in a positive way they are 1) Letting go/Generosity, 2) Loving-Kindness and ClarityWisdom. Every moment that we're mindful we're cultivating these qualities. This talk explores both the moment-to-moment as well as the relational aspects of these three qualities.

2019-02-20 Cultivating Meditative Absorptions (Jhanas) (Retreat at Spirit Rock) 63:40
Tempel Smith
There are two larger categories of meditation: samatha meditations and vipassana meditations. Samatha meditations are intended to calm, unify, balance and develop strengths of the heart, and vipassana meditations lead toward insight into our patterns of suffering, confusion, clarity and freedom. The samatha meditations can develop to the point where we are fully absorbed into our meditation subject. This talk describes this process.
